Extreme diving in key Black Sea In recent years, extreme diving is becoming fashionable and very popular. The main types of diving: cave-diving (diving and walking on an underwater caves), and river-diving (the study of wrecks). Objects of study rivers are diving ships sunk during the war and the crashes, as well as trains, cars and airplanes. Remains on the seabed for any reason. Today lifting baggage or cargo from wrecks is prohibited activities throughout the world, requiring a special permit. Wreck diving is nothing more than a risky underwater tour of this wreck, which represent tsennst like objects on photo vintage cars. In the territorial waters of the peninsula of Crimea is a huge number of ships, submarines and aircraft. Most of them are inaccessible to divers. All wrecks are divided into several groups depending on the depth and complexity of the dive. The first group - the depth of 15 m. The second group - up to 30 meters and a third to 50 m. The latter is considered the most difficult level for diving requires special training. Here are the most well-known objects that are trying to explore the divers, extreme. Batiliman - a cargo ship which sank in front of the Great Patriotic War. Sometimes it is erroneously called Greek vinovozom. At the bottom of the underwater wasp, which is a continuation of the Cape Chersonese is a large number of modern and ancient anchors, also did not ever get caught and ceramic products, which have witnessed the disasters of past centuries. in Balaklava Bay sank an English ship "Prince", which according to legend carried a cash reward soldiers to England.
